CHILDREN AND FAMILIES: LIFECYCLE APPROACH

Beginning in the corridors of education, Womencare Foundation adopted a lifecycle approach and extended its thematic areas of intervention by supporting family health, livelihood, and women empowerment. Children, their families and the community become the target group for Womencare Foundation’s activities as child education cannot be done in isolation, without
ensuring the welfare of the whole family. Following the lifecycle approach, Womencare Foundation has directly impacted the lives of over 1.5 Thousand children and families so far.

ENVIRONMENTAWARENESS PROGRAM

6th October 2022 at Sector 34, Chandigarh

The Environment Awareness Program was successfully conducted on October 6, 2022, at Sector 34, Chandigarh. Participants engaged in discussions and activities promoting sustainability, conservation, and the importance of protecting our environment.

FOOD DISTRIBUTION DRIVE

9th December 2022 at PGI Chandigarh

On December 9, 2022, a Food Distribution Drive was held at PGI Chandigarh,
providing essential food supplies to those in need, fostering community
support, and promoting compassion and generosity among participants.

CLOTHES &
BLANKET
DISTRIBUTION

1st February 2023 at PGI Chandigarh

On February 1, 2023, a Clothes and Blanket Distribution event took place at PGI
Chandigarh, providing warm clothing and blankets to those in need, ensuring comfort and support during the winter season
